Designed for heavy-duty applications where slip resistance, load-bearing capacity, and corrosion protection are paramount, galvanized metal grating is the go-to solution for walkways, platforms, drainage covers, and mezzanine floors across oil rigs, factories, and transportation hubs. Fabricated from carbon steel bars welded or press-locked into grid patterns, it undergoes hot-dip galvanization to form a metallurgically bonded zinc coating that resists rust for decades.
Galvanized metal grating excels in open-area efficiency: its perforated design allows light, air, water, and debris to pass through, reducing accumulation and maintenance costs. Standard configurations include serrated tops for enhanced traction in wet or oily environments, and custom cutouts for pipes or conduits. Load ratings range from pedestrian use (Class A) to vehicular traffic (Class E), certified under standards like ASTM A123 or ISO 1461.
Unlike solid plates, grating minimizes material use while maximizing strength-to-weight ratio. It’s also easily replaceable in sections, limiting downtime during repairs. In modern infrastructure, galvanized metal grating isn’t just functional—it’s a critical safety component that prevents falls, improves visibility, and ensures operational continuity in the harshest conditions.
